On this 2-hour walking tour (just under 2 miles at an easy pace), you’ll hear real stories of rival gangsters gunning each other down right after church, psychopaths hiding in plain sight, and the unforgettable disasters that scarred Chicago’s past—from the Haymarket Affair to the Iroquois Fire to the Eastland Disaster. Along the way, you’ll step inside a few historic interiors where gangsters once gathered and where ghosts are still said to roam.
We’ll also dive into the origins of ghost lore: are people really seeing specters, or does the strange design of some buildings simply play tricks on the mind? You’ll learn why certain spots get labeled “haunted,” and decide for yourself if Chicago’s spookiest stories are fact, fiction, or something in between.
